summary refs log tree commit diff
diff options
context:
space:
mode:
authorDaniel Peebles <copumpkin@users.noreply.github.com>2016-02-02 13:09:23 -0500
committerDaniel Peebles <copumpkin@users.noreply.github.com>2016-02-02 13:09:23 -0500
commit9c9230c8f76a87259e74ba297504f13fb4eff1a4 (patch)
treebd945696990b35ee235d57449739931072f6cbfd
parent61042a5b6ac89166180b9257fa72c478439d3753 (diff)
parentdb5fe1f8f4b14baa01fcc780ad7dfea2c0c4fe2f (diff)
downloadnixlib-9c9230c8f76a87259e74ba297504f13fb4eff1a4.tar
nixlib-9c9230c8f76a87259e74ba297504f13fb4eff1a4.tar.gz
nixlib-9c9230c8f76a87259e74ba297504f13fb4eff1a4.tar.bz2
nixlib-9c9230c8f76a87259e74ba297504f13fb4eff1a4.tar.lz
nixlib-9c9230c8f76a87259e74ba297504f13fb4eff1a4.tar.xz
nixlib-9c9230c8f76a87259e74ba297504f13fb4eff1a4.tar.zst
nixlib-9c9230c8f76a87259e74ba297504f13fb4eff1a4.zip
Merge pull request #11561 from fxfactorial/master
darling: init at Dec 8, 2015
-rw-r--r--pkgs/tools/filesystems/darling-dmg/default.nix20
-rw-r--r--pkgs/top-level/all-packages.nix2
2 files changed, 22 insertions, 0 deletions
diff --git a/pkgs/tools/filesystems/darling-dmg/default.nix b/pkgs/tools/filesystems/darling-dmg/default.nix
new file mode 100644
index 000000000000..a8c9c03fc729
--- /dev/null
+++ b/pkgs/tools/filesystems/darling-dmg/default.nix
@@ -0,0 +1,20 @@
+{ stdenv, fetchFromGitHub, lib, cmake, fuse, zlib, bzip2, openssl, libxml2, icu } :
+
+stdenv.mkDerivation rec {
+  name = "darling-dmg-${version}";
+  version = "1.0";
+  src = fetchFromGitHub {
+    owner = "darlinghq";
+    repo = "darling-dmg";
+    rev = "9522e3907b82f6cde141b3e0e0063f09c8710cbf";
+    sha256 = "5d968b0609f9bfbecc26753d21b5182e15183b672967f7dec6038404cd6a6d7f";
+  };
+  buildInputs = [ cmake fuse openssl zlib bzip2 libxml2 icu ];
+  cmakeConfigureFlagFlags = ["-DCMAKE_BUILD_TYPE=RELEASE"];
+  meta = {
+    homepage = http://www.darlinghq.org/;
+    description = "Darling lets you open OS X dmgs on Linux";
+    platforms = stdenv.lib.platforms.linux;
+    license = stdenv.lib.licenses.gpl3;
+  };
+}
di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ix
index 235b8becebab..390032f980da 100644
--- a/pkgs/top-level/all-packages.nix
+++ b/pkgs/top-level/all-packages.nix
@@ -15406,6 +15406,8 @@ let
 
   darcnes = callPackage ../misc/emulators/darcnes { };
 
+  darling-dmg = callPackage ../tools/filesystems/darling-dmg { };
+
   desmume = callPackage ../misc/emulators/desmume { inherit (pkgs.gnome) gtkglext libglade; };
 
   dbacl = callPackage ../tools/misc/dbacl { };